What Is Included in a Luxury Maasai Mara Lodge Rate?
Luxury Maasai Mara lodge rates are usually priced per person per night and often include more than a room. All-inclusive plans may cover accommodation, meals, drinks, game drives, and park fees . However, each property defines “all-inclusive” in its own way, so the written itinerary matters.
Known for: Full-service safari stays
Luxury lodges are known for combining a private room or suite with daily wildlife activities. A standard package may include breakfast, lunch, dinner, selected drinks, and scheduled game drives. Some plans also include transfers or guided walks, but you should confirm those items in writing.
Park fees are a major cost to check. A quote that excludes fees may look cheaper at first. The Mara Triangle also requires cashless payment at Oloololo Gate and Purungat Bridge. Accepted methods include Visa, Mastercard, and M-Pesa .
Why the same nightly rate can offer different value
Location affects the safari experience. A lodge close to a wildlife-rich area may reduce drive time. A private conservancy stay may offer a quieter setting and different activities. The rate also reflects room size, views, guest numbers, food, guiding, and service.
Mara Serena Safari Lodge has 74 rooms and offers full-board accommodation . Its larger size can suit first-time visitors and groups. A smaller luxury camp may offer more privacy, but it may also charge more per guest.

How Do 2027 Luxury Lodge Nightly Rates Compare?
Luxury Maasai Mara lodge prices range from about US$500 to more than US$1,500 per person per night in 2027. Cottar’s 1920s Camp is listed at US$571 in one comparison, while Angama Mara is listed from US$2,750 per person per night. These figures show why you should compare inclusions, not rates alone.
| Name | Price | Duration | Rating | Best For |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Luxury Maasai Mara lodge range | US$500–US$1,500+ per person per night | Nightly rate | Not provided | Travelers comparing luxury tiers |
| Cottar’s 1920s Camp | From US$571 per night | Nightly rate | Not provided | Classic camp style |
| Angama Mara | From US$2,750 per person per night | Nightly rate | Not provided | High-end views and premium service |
| Mara Serena Safari Lodge | Rate not provided | Nightly rate | Not provided | Groups and full-board stays |
Cottar’s 1920s Camp is listed at US$571 per night in a luxury lodge comparison . That figure gives you a useful lower-end benchmark. The source does not state whether the rate is per person or per room, so ask for the exact occupancy basis.
Angama Mara is listed from US$2,750 per person per night by Safari.com . This price sits well above the common luxury range. It shows how premium design, location, service, and package structure can create a much higher rate.
Price range: A simple 2027 planning model
- Mid-range: US$200–US$400 per night, according to Kitumo Mara’s guide .
- Luxury: US$500–US$1,000+ per night, according to Kitumo Mara .
- High luxury: US$1,000–US$1,500+ per person per night, based on SafariFind’s 2027 lodge guide .
- Ultra-premium example: Angama Mara from US$2,750 per person per night .
These bands help you set a budget before requesting quotes. For example, two guests spending three nights at US$750 per person per night would start at US$4,500. That total excludes any items outside the quoted plan.

How to Calculate Masai Mara Safari Cost in Kenya
How to Calculate Masai Mara Safari Cost in Kenya starts with the nightly lodge rate. Multiply the per-person rate by the number of guests and nights. Then add park fees, transport, flights, drinks, activities, and tips when those items are not included.
- Write down the lodge rate per person or room.
- Multiply the rate by nights and travelers.
- Check whether meals and drinks are included.
- Check whether game drives and park fees are included.
- Add airport transfers and other requested activities.
- Ask for a final total in writing.

What Should You Check Before Booking?
The best luxury Maasai Mara booking includes a clear price, room type, meal plan, activities, and payment schedule. Ask for these details before you compare one offer with another. A written quote protects you from confusing per-room and per-person rates.
Important questions for every operator
- Is the price per person or per room?
- Does the rate include breakfast, lunch, dinner, and drinks?
- Are game drives private or shared?
- Are park fees included in the total?
- What happens if a flight or road transfer changes?
- Does the lodge accept children, and what ages are allowed?
- What deposit and cancellation rules apply?
- Which payment methods can you use at the lodge or gate?
SafariFind’s lodge and operator listings can help you compare travel styles. Read authentic reviews before making a choice. Look for comments about guide quality, food, room comfort, transfer planning, and how the operator handled changes.
How to compare luxury lodges fairly
Compare the same number of nights and guests. Use the same room basis for every quote. Then separate the cost into accommodation, meals, game drives, fees, and transport.
For example, a US$900 rate with meals, drives, and fees may offer better value than a US$700 room-only rate. The lower figure does not automatically mean a lower trip cost.
